Sometimes all I can...I have the same cheese issue. Sometimes all I can think about is havarti with dill. My advice, don't deprive yourself, it will only make you want it more and more until you binge on it. What I do is go buy my stupid cheese that won't get out of my head and cut it up into the thinnest slices you have ever seen...I've been known to use a potato peeler to achieve this effect. The I measure it out. Put it all in separate bags and have one bag for each meal and my two snacks. By the end of the day I can't say I haven't had my fair share of cheese and I didn't binge on it.
